What are the responsibilities and job description for the Embedded Peer Tutor (Part-time Student Employee) position at mbcc-mass?
Key Responsibilities and Duties:
Attend all class meetings (including labs) for the course/section you are supporting;
Plan and facilitate two one-hour study sessions per week based the availability and needs of students enrolled in the course;
Attend Embedded Peer Tutor trainings;
Lead individual appointments;
Inform direct supervisors of session meeting times and locations;
Track student attendance for study sessions;
Assist students in developing time management, communication, and study skills to promote academic success within the course;
Maintain consistent communication with your direct supervisors;
Assist students in navigating College systems and understanding course expectations;
Help students in locating and submitting assignments;
Provide support to students through WebEx, Zoom, email, or on-campus meetings;
Be aware of and advocate for the other resources and services provided at MassBay Community College;
Model appropriate academic attitudes and behaviors to staff, faculty, and students;
Complete other tasks as assigned.
